Python
Java
PHP
IOS
Android
Nodejs
JavaScript
Html5
Windows
Ubuntu
Linux
如何调试 MySQL 上的锁等待超时?
在我的生产错误日志中 我偶尔会看到 SQLSTATE HY000 一般错误 1205 超过锁等待超时 尝试 重新开始交易 我知道当时哪个查询正在尝试访问数据库 但是有没有办法找出哪个查询在那个精确时刻拥有锁定 暴露这一点的是这个词交易 从该
mysql
debugging
Transactions
InnoDB
ACID
Haskell:Yesod 和状态
我正在阅读代码玩具 URL 缩短器 http flygdynamikern blogspot com au 2011 06 toy url shortener with yesod and acid html 然而 有一些重要的部分我就是无
Haskell
State
yesod
ACID
为什么可重复读取会出现写入倾斜?
Wiki https en wikipedia org wiki Isolation database systems says 可重复读取 在此隔离级别中 基于锁 并发控制 DBMS 实现保持读写锁 在选定的数据上获取 直到交易结束 然而
database
isolationlevel
ACID
如果 Cassandra 报告失败但进行了部分写入该怎么办?
Cassandra 不保证原子行为 因此一个副本失败但其他副本确实保留更改的可能性很小 是否有任何信息如何防范这种情况以及如果发生这种情况应采取哪些措施来治愈它 卡桑德拉在这方面能自我治愈吗 Update 我特别关注这样一种情况 您向所有副
Transactions
cassandra
ACID
CAP定理是否意味着ACID对于分布式数据库是不可能的?
有NoSQL ACID 分布式 数据库 https stackoverflow com questions 2608103 is there any nosql that is acid compliant 尽管有 CAP 定理 这怎么可能
database
NoSQL
distributedcomputing
distributedtransactions
ACID
内存映射文件和单个块的原子写入
如果我使用普通 IO API 读取和写入单个文件 则保证每个块的写入都是原子的 也就是说 如果我的写入仅修改单个块 则操作系统保证要么写入整个块 要么什么也不写入 如何在内存映射文件上达到相同的效果 内存映射文件只是字节数组 因此如果我修改
atomic
mmap
fwrite
ACID
Oracle和PostgreSQL中的Write Skew异常不回滚事务
我注意到 Oracle 和 PostgreSQL 中都发生了以下情况 考虑到我们有以下数据库架构 create table post id int8 not null title varchar 255 version int4 not n
Oracle
postgresql
Transactions
Serializable
ACID
回滚时,App 和 DB 哪个应该主动执行任务?
MySql InnoDB 设置自动提交关闭并使用默认隔离级别 REPEATABLE READ 有两种场景 两个不同的事务 T1 和 T2 按以下时间顺序运行 1 time T1 T2 t1 update row 1 gt OK t2 upd
mysql
database
Transactions
rollback
ACID
非 ACID 数据库合规性对现实世界有哪些影响?
具体来说 是否存在数据丢失的风险 我正在考虑运行一个密集型事务处理系统 其中最重要的是不要丢失任何内容 是否有在银行交易处理等关键任务应用程序中使用 NoSQL 的示例 坦白说 缺乏 ACID 意味着您无法保证原子性 一致性 隔离性或持久性
database
NoSQL
ACID
是否有任何符合 ACID 的 NoSQL 数据存储?
想要改进这篇文章吗 提供此问题的详细答案 包括引用和解释为什么你的答案是正确的 不够详细的答案可能会被编辑或删除 有没有NoSQL数据存储是ACID符合吗 我将其发布为纯粹为了支持对话的答案 Tim Mahy nawroth and Cra
database
NoSQL
ACID
简单聊一聊 Spring 事务传播行为和事务隔离级别的那些事
前言 Spring的事务 也就是数据库的事务操作 符合ACID标准 也具有标准的事务隔离级别 所以Spring的事务隔离级别和事务的传播行为是面试中经常考察的问题 下面简单做下总结 事务并发引发的问题 脏读 一个事务读取到了另一个事务修改但
Java
ACID
Spring
简说数据库事务的ACID
事务是应用程序中一系列严密的操作 所有操作必须成功完成 否则在每个操作中所作的所有更改都会被撤消 也就是事务具有原子性 一个事务中的一系列的操作要么全部成功 要么一个都不做 原子性 Atomicity 一致性 Consistency 隔离性
mysql
数据库
ACID
事务
数据库事务详解:ACID四性、隔离级别、日志、事务控制语句
目录 事务的特性 事务的隔离级别 事务日志 事务控制语句 数据库中的事务用来管理增 删 改操作 查询不需要事务管理 因为它并不会修改数据库中的数据 在 MySQL 中只有使用了InnoDB 数据库引擎 的数据库或表才支持事务 事务的特性 事
数据库
mysql
sql
ACID
关系型数据库ACID与非关系型数据的CAP
ACID 事务的原子性 Atomicity 是指一个事务要么全部执行 要么不执行 也就是说一个事务不可能只执行了一半就停止了 比如你从取款机取钱 这个事务可以分成两个步骤 1划卡 2出钱 不可能划了卡 而钱却没出来 这两步必须同时完成 要么
数据持久层
CAP
ACID
解读事务的ACID!
事务的ACID特性大学数据库课程基本都学过 xff0c 但是学完也就大概知道是干嘛的 xff0c 后来也没仔细想这个东西了 xff0c 后来接触了NoSQL系统的一致性 xff0c 于是重新学习 ACID xff0c 发现还有很多误区 今天
ACID
解读事务
Redis-事物&事物的四大特性(ACID)
Redis事物 事物是指一系列操作步骤 xff0c 这一系列操作步骤 xff0c 要么完全执行 xff0c 要么完全不执行 Redis中的事物 transaction 是一组命令的集合 xff0c 至少是两个或两个以上的命令 xff0c r
Redis
amp
ACID
事物的四大特性